在现代网络环境中,安全性与隐私性愈加重要。Shadowsocks作为一种高效的代理工具,被广泛应用于科学上网、保护隐私等场景。本文将深入探讨Shadowsocks的端口选择,帮助用户在配置过程中作出最佳决策。
1. 什么是Shadowsocks?
Shadowsocks是一种基于SOCKS5的代理工具,旨在保护用户的上网隐私。通过将用户的网络流量加密并通过中间服务器转发,Shadowsocks有效地防止了流量监控和审查。
2. Shadowsocks的工作原理
- 客户端:用户的设备上安装Shadowsocks客户端。
- 服务器:用户连接到的远程服务器,通常会安装Shadowsocks服务端。
- 端口:客户端与服务端之间进行数据交换的通道,选择合适的端口对于数据传输的稳定性和安全性至关重要。
3. Shadowsocks端口的类型
在Shadowsocks中,有多种类型的端口可以选择,常见的包括:
- HTTP端口:通常为80或8080,适合访问普通网页。
- HTTPS端口:通常为443,适合访问安全网站。
- 随机端口:不固定的端口,能有效避开检测。
- 自定义端口:用户可以根据需求选择特定端口。
4. 选择合适的端口的策略
在选择Shadowsocks端口时,考虑以下几个因素:
4.1 网络环境
- ISP限制:一些互联网服务提供商可能会限制特定端口的流量,选择常见端口(如80、443)可有效规避这些限制。
- 防火墙设置:在某些网络环境中,防火墙可能会封锁非标准端口,需考虑是否可通行。
4.2 使用场景
- 日常浏览:一般建议使用80和443端口。
- 观看视频:可选择自定义端口,确保更高的带宽。
- 隐私保护:推荐使用随机端口,以增强隐私保护。
4.3 性能和稳定性
- 选择负载较低的端口,可以提升传输速度和稳定性。通过监测网络流量,选择较少使用的端口也是一种策略。
5. 如何修改Shadowsocks的端口设置
以下是修改Shadowsocks端口的步骤:
- 打开Shadowsocks客户端。
- 进入设置,找到“服务器设置”或“配置文件”。
- 修改端口,输入选择的端口号。
- 保存并重启客户端。
- 测试连接,确保新的设置正常工作。
6. Shadowsocks常见问题解答
6.1 Shadowsocks可以使用哪些端口?
Shadowsocks可以使用的端口包括:
- 80(HTTP)
- 443(HTTPS)
- 8080(HTTP代理)
- 任何用户自定义的端口
6.2 如何选择Shadowsocks的最佳端口?
选择最佳端口需考虑网络环境、使用场景和性能需求。通常建议使用常见的HTTP/HTTPS端口以规避检测。随机端口也可提高隐私性。
6.3 如果Shadowsocks连接不上该怎么办?
- 检查输入的服务器地址和端口是否正确。
- 确认网络连接是否正常。
- 更换其他端口进行尝试。
- 重新安装Shadowsocks客户端。
6.4 使用Shadowsocks的端口选择对速度有影响吗?
是的,选择不当的端口可能导致速度下降,使用负载较低的端口可以提升速度。
6.5 Shadowsocks支持的加密方式有哪些?
Shadowsocks支持多种加密方式,包括:
- AES-256-GCM
- CHACHA20
- AES-128-GCM等。
7. 结语
通过合理的端口选择,用户可以大幅提升Shadowsocks的使用体验,确保在使用过程中的隐私和安全性。希望本文能帮助用户在实际操作中作出明智的决定,享受更流畅的上网体验。
正文完